Description

Ethanone, 1-(2-Fluoro-1-Hydroxycyclohexyl)-, trans- (9Ci) CAS NO 119030-21-6 is a specialized fluorinated ketone derivative featuring a cyclohexyl ring with hydroxyl and fluoro substituents. This compound is valued as a versatile chiral building block and intermediate in advanced organic synthesis, particularly for introducing fluorine atoms and complex stereochemistry into target molecules. It is primarily needed by R&D chemists and process development teams in the pharmaceutical, agrochemical, and advanced material sectors for the synthesis of novel active ingredients and functional molecules.

Basic Information

Product Name Ethanone, 1-(2-Fluoro-1-Hydroxycyclohexyl)-, trans- (9Ci)
CAS No. 119030-21-6
Molecular Formula C8H13FO2
Molecular Weight 160.19 g/mol
Synonyms trans-1-(2-Fluoro-1-hydroxycyclohexyl)ethanone; 1-(2-Fluoro-1-hydroxycyclohexyl)ethanone, trans-; 2-Fluoro-1-(1-hydroxycyclohexyl)ethanone (trans isomer); 119030-21-6; trans-2-Fluoro-1-hydroxycyclohexyl methyl ketone; (1R,2S)-1-(2-Fluoro-1-hydroxycyclohexyl)ethanone (relative stereochemistry); Fluorocyclohexyl hydroxy ketone

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ed under an inert atmosphere (e.g., nitrogen or argon) after opening to prevent degradation. Keep away from incompatible materials such as strong bases and fluorides.
